**Role: Software Dev Eng, Payload Phased Arrays, Amazon Leo** Drive antenna system validation for Amazon's LEO satellite network. Collaborate cross-functionally to bring up and test complex systems combining FPGA, firmware, RF, and networking. Key responsibilities include subsystem characterization, complex data storage, hardware test automation, firmware design, and application development. Build advanced tools and scripts for phased array systems. 2+ years' experience in software development required. Hands-on with Linux, Python, C/C++, and hardware description languages. Experience with AWR (e.g., AFE, Microwave Office) or other RF simulation tools a plus. U.S. citizenship or permanent residency required due to export controls.

Amazon Leo is Amazon’s low Earth orbit satellite network. Our mission is to deliver fast, reliable internet connectivity to customers beyond the reach of existing networks. From individual households to schools, hospitals, businesses, and government agencies, Amazon Leo will serve people and organizations operating in locations without reliable connectivity.

As a Software Engineer for antenna calibration, you will collaborate with systems architects, hardware engineering design teams & FW/SW design teams to bring up and test systems combining FPGA, firmware, RF, and networking functions and build advanced tools for the following:

Characterizing subsystems and systems related to antennas
Complex data storage
Hardware test automation
Firmware design and implementation
Application development
Develop bring up tools and scripts for phased array systems

Export Control Requirement: Due to applicable export control laws and regulations, candidates must be a U.S. citizen or national, U.S. permanent resident (i.e., current Green Card holder), or lawfully admitted into the U.S. as a refugee or granted asylum.

Basic Qualifications

- Bachelor's degree or foreign equivalent in Computer Science, Engineering, Mathematics, or a related field
- 2+ years of non-internship professional software development experience

Preferred Qualifications

- 3+ years of full software development life cycle, including coding standards, code reviews, source control management, build processes, testing, and operations experience
- Master's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Mathematics, or a related field
